Gochujang Bean Sprout and Kale Bibimbap with Sesame Miso Dressing is a delightful twist on the traditional Korean dish, bibimbap. This vibrant dish combines the spicy, umami flavors of gochujang with the nutty, earthy notes of sesame miso dressing. Crisp bean sprouts and tender kale add freshness and texture, while a variety of seasonal vegetables complement the dish. Served over a bed of warm rice, this bibimbap is both wholesome and satisfying. Loved for its harmonious blend of flavors and textures, it’s a healthy, nutritious meal that caters to a wide range of palates. Directions

Step 1

Cook the rice according to package instructions until fluffy.

Step 2

Blanch the kale in boiling water for 1 minute, then drain and set aside.

Step 3

Stir-fry the bean sprouts, carrot, and zucchini in a pan with a bit of sesame oil until tender.

Step 4

In a small bowl, mix gochujang, soy sauce, miso paste, and sesame oil to make the dressing.

Step 5

In a large bowl, combine the cooked rice, vegetables, and kale, then drizzle with the sesame miso dressing.

Step 6

Serve the bibimbap warm, garnished with a sprinkle of sesame seeds if desired.
